#36b4ee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#36b4ee is composed of 21.2% red, 70.6%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.3% cyan, 24.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 198.9 degrees, a saturation of 84.4% and a lightness of 57.3%. #36b4ee color hex could be obtained by blending #6cffff with #0069dd.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

Shades and Tints of #36b4ee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b10 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#36b4ee

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a959a is the less saturated color, while #25baff is the most saturated one.
